Low Current DC-DC Converter With Integrated Low Current Coulomb Counter

A power supply system includes a regulator circuit responsive to an input signal at the input node (VIN) for producing an output signal at the output node (VOUT) at a desired level. The regulator circuit has a controller (12), an inductive element (L) and a first switch coupled to the inductor element (A) and controlled by the controller to produce the output signal. Also, the power supply system includes a Coulomb counter (22) for producing a Coulomb count signal proportional to the number of Coulombs passing from the input node to the output node. The Coulomb counter is enabled by an enabling signal representing a predetermined time period, for determining the number of Coulombs passing from the input node to the output node during that predetermined time period.
